Check your references, I'm not positive about the F model, but I'm pretty sure all the canopies were similar in their opening mechanism.

The two side panels "rolled down" into the fuselage similar to an automobile, and the top part was hinged in the back. A latch was released up in the front and it flipped backwards on that hinge.

On all P-38 models through the P-38E, the top canopy was hinged on the right. Some P-38F early production also had it, but it was changed during P-38F production to hinging at the back. All subsequent variants had a rear hinged canopy top.
